首页 > 精选资讯 > 严选问答 >

冗余性原则

2025-12-19 06:53:50

问题描述:

冗余性原则,在线等,求大佬翻牌!

最佳答案

推荐答案

2025-12-19 06:53:50

冗余性原则】在系统设计、信息传输、数据存储以及组织管理等多个领域中,冗余性原则是一个至关重要的概念。它指的是通过引入重复或备用的结构、资源或流程,以提高系统的可靠性、容错能力和稳定性。该原则的核心在于通过“多一份保障”来应对可能发生的故障或风险,从而确保关键功能在异常情况下仍能正常运行。

一、冗余性原则的基本定义

冗余性原则是指在系统设计中,通过添加额外的组件、路径或机制,使系统具备在部分组件失效时仍能继续工作的能力。其目的是提高系统的可靠性和可用性,减少因单一故障点导致的整体崩溃风险。

二、冗余性原则的应用场景

应用领域 冗余性体现形式 目标与作用
计算机系统 硬盘RAID、双电源、备份服务器 防止硬件故障导致数据丢失或服务中断
通信网络 多条通信链路、备用路由协议 提高网络连接的稳定性和抗断能力
数据存储 多副本存储、分布式存储系统(如HDFS) 防止数据丢失,提高读写效率
组织管理 多人负责同一任务、岗位AB角制度 减少因人员变动或失误带来的影响
工业控制 双控制器、备用传感器、自动切换机制 保障生产过程的安全与连续性

三、冗余性原则的优点

1. 提高系统可靠性:即使某个部分出现故障,系统仍可继续运行。

2. 增强容错能力:能够处理突发的异常情况,避免系统瘫痪。

3. 提升可用性:用户可以持续访问服务,减少停机时间。

4. 便于维护和升级:可以在不影响整体运行的情况下进行维护或更新。

四、冗余性原则的挑战

1. 成本增加:需要更多的设备、资源或人力投入。

2. 复杂性上升:系统结构更复杂,管理难度加大。

3. 维护负担加重:多个冗余单元需同步维护,容易出现配置不一致问题。

4. 性能损失:某些情况下,冗余可能导致效率下降。

五、总结

冗余性原则是现代系统设计中不可或缺的一部分,尤其在对安全性、稳定性要求较高的场景中显得尤为重要。虽然实施冗余会带来一定的成本和复杂度,但其带来的可靠性和容错能力,往往远超这些代价。合理应用冗余性原则,能够在最大程度上保障系统运行的连续性和数据的安全性。

注:本文内容为原创撰写,结合实际应用场景与理论分析,避免AI生成内容的常见模式,力求提供更具深度和实用性的信息。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。